【发布时间】:2011-11-22 04:33:50
【问题描述】:
我想知道如何表示两个实体之间的关系,这意味着“至少”。
例如,一首歌必须是至少一张专辑的一部分。
如果“一首歌可以是一张或多张专辑的一部分”是指歌曲和专辑之间的一对多关系,那么上面给出的 Eg 的 ER 图会是什么?
【问题讨论】:
标签: entity-relationship rdbms database modeling er-diagrams
我想知道如何表示两个实体之间的关系,这意味着“至少”。
例如,一首歌必须是至少一张专辑的一部分。
如果“一首歌可以是一张或多张专辑的一部分”是指歌曲和专辑之间的一对多关系,那么上面给出的 Eg 的 ER 图会是什么?
【问题讨论】:
标签: entity-relationship rdbms database modeling er-diagrams
它在 ERD 上用双线表示(称为参与约束)。
如果一首歌可以出现在多张专辑中,则需要一个连接表,如下所示:
album -+------< album_song >------+- song
【讨论】: